Empowering Rural Women in Pakistan – Inside the Nestlé-BISP Rural Women Sales Program 2025

The Nestlé-BISP Rural Women Sales Program 2025 is a groundbreaking partnership between Nestlé Pakistan and the Benazir Income Support Programme (BISP). Together, these two organizations are working to uplift women in Pakistan’s rural areas by helping them build small businesses, learn new skills, and earn a steady income. This program isn’t just about money—it’s about confidence, independence, and long-term community development.

A Joint Effort for Empowerment

Nestlé and BISP launched this initiative to give women the tools they need to improve their lives. Many women in rural Pakistan depend on BISP’s financial assistance, but this program goes a step further. Instead of only providing cash support, it teaches women how to run small sales businesses and earn profits by selling Nestlé dairy and nutrition products in their own communities.

Women registered with BISP 8171 can join the program after completing the required training. Once trained, they start selling products like milk, cereals, and nutrition items. The goal is simple: to help women move from financial dependence to financial independence.

Training That Builds Confidence

At the heart of the Nestlé-BISP initiative is education and skill development. Every participant receives hands-on training to help them succeed in sales and entrepreneurship. The training covers four main areas:

  • Product Knowledge: Women learn about the features and benefits of Nestlé products so they can confidently answer customer questions.

  • Sales Techniques: Participants are taught how to communicate effectively, approach customers, and build lasting relationships in their communities.

  • Financial Literacy: Women learn basic money management—how to budget, calculate profit margins, and manage small business accounts.

  • Business Ethics: Emphasis is placed on fair pricing, honesty, and customer trust, helping women establish themselves as respected business owners.

This combination of knowledge and confidence turns participants into local leaders who inspire others to follow their path.

How Women Earn Through the Program

The income model is simple yet powerful. Nestlé supplies products to trained women at discounted rates. These women then sell the products in nearby villages or markets and earn a profit margin on each sale.

For example, if a participant sells Nestlé products worth Rs. 20,000 a month, she can earn between Rs. 3,000 and Rs. 5,000 as profit. For many families, this extra income means being able to afford school fees, household items, or healthcare costs. Over time, these small profits can lead to significant financial stability.

The program also encourages peer-to-peer learning, where successful women help train new participants, spreading the benefits to even more families and communities.

Overcoming Challenges

While the program has been successful, rural women often face challenges such as limited transportation, cultural barriers, and poor digital access. Nestlé and BISP continue to provide guidance, mentorship, and practical solutions—like creating more local distribution points and introducing digital training—to help women overcome these obstacles.

Looking Ahead: The Future of the Program

The Nestlé-BISP partnership plans to expand across Pakistan with new features such as:

  • Digital Sales Platforms for online selling

  • Micro-financing options to grow small businesses

  • Wider product ranges for better customer reach

  • Urban partnerships to connect rural sellers with larger markets

These upcoming initiatives aim to make the program even more sustainable and inclusive in the years ahead.
